I have been pin-head since I first found The Addams Family back in the early 90's in a local bowling alley. In those days it was all-TAF-and-T2-all -the-time for me. I dabbled in a little Guns 'N Roses and Creature From the Black Lagoon before going off to school (and into the pinball desert). When I got back to Dallas I came across The Twilight Zone in a local dive bar, and proceeded to spend the next year only hanging out in that one establishment.
After TZ was taken off of that route I got into traveling around searching for pins around the Dallas area. Things got pretty slim, and I eventually came across a TAF for sale at a good price, and I snapped it up. It isn't the nicest example, but it plays 100% and without error, and the game is overall still very nice.
I recently picked up a Whitewater as my second pin, and am now out of room. I intend to either be in the market for a new house (with a huge gameroom) in the next year, or will be building on to my existing house. I am always on the lookout for good deals, and intend to own Attack From Mars and TZ at some point in the near future.
